`

八个最佳Python IDE

 
阅读更多

http://blog.csdn.net/chszs/article/details/45922299

八个最佳Python IDE

作者:chszs,转载需注明。博客主页:http://blog.csdn.net/chszs

Python是一种功能强大、语言简洁的编程语言。本文向大家推荐8个适合Python开发的IDE。

1. Eclipse with PyDev

http://pydev.org/

这里写图片描述

Eclipse+PyDev插件,很适合开发Python Web应用,其特征包括自动代码完成、语法高亮、代码分析、调试器、以及内置的交互浏览器。

2. Komodo Edit

http://komodoide.com/komodo-edit/

这里写图片描述

Komodo Edit是一个免费的、开源的、专业的Python IDE,其特征是非菜单的操作方式,开发高效。

3. Vim

http://www.vim.org/download.php

这里写图片描述

Vim是一个简洁、高效的工具,也适合做Python开发。

4. Sublime Text

http://www.sublimetext.com/

这里写图片描述

SublimeText也是适合Python开发的IDE工具,SublimeText虽然仅仅是一个编辑器,但是它有丰富的插件,使得对Python开发的支持非常到位。

5. Pycharm

http://www.jetbrains.com/pycharm/

这里写图片描述

Pycharm是一个跨平台的Python开发工具,是JetBrains公司的产品。其特征包括:自动代码完成、集成的Python调试器、括号自动匹配、代码折叠。Pycharm支持Windows、MacOS以及Linux等系统,而且可以远程开发、调试、运行程序。

6. Emacs

http://www.gnu.org/software/emacs/

这里写图片描述

Emacs是一个可扩展的文本编辑器,同样支持Python开发。Emacs本身以Lisp解释器作为其核心,而且包含了大量的扩展。

7. Wing

https://wingware.com/

这里写图片描述

Wing是一个Python语言的超强IDE,适合做交互式的Python开发。Wing IDE同样支持自动代码完成、代码错误检查、开发技巧提示等,而且Wing IDE也支持多种操作系统,包括Windows、Linux和Mac OS X。

8. Pyscripter

https://code.google.com/p/pyscripter/

这里写图片描述

Pyscriptor是一个开源的Python集成开发环境,很富有竞争力,同样有诸如代码自动完成、语法检查、视图分割文件编辑等功能。

分享到:
评论

相关推荐

    7款好用的PythonIDE工具推荐共4页.pdf.zip

    Sublime Text是一款轻量级的文本编辑器,通过安装Python相关的插件,如SublimeLinter和Anaconda,可以将其转变为一个功能完备的Python IDE。它的速度快,自定义性强,支持多窗口编辑和强大的快捷键操作。 7. Atom ...

    python开发IDE安装包

    PyCharm是由JetBrains公司开发的一款强大的Python IDE,被广泛认为是Python开发的最佳选择之一。2018.1.3版本提供了以下主要特性: 1. **智能代码补全**:PyCharm可以智能地分析代码上下文,提供准确的代码补全建议...

    tools-new-python-ide

    标题 "tools-new-python-ide" 暗示我们要讨论的是一个新的Python集成开发环境(IDE),而描述中的相同信息进一步确认了这一点。PyCharm是一款由JetBrains公司开发的广泛使用的Python IDE,它提供了丰富的功能来支持...

    两个命令把 Vim 打造成 Python IDE的方法

    标题中的“两个命令把 Vim 打造成 Python IDE”指的是通过执行特定的命令行指令,将 Vim 配置成一个功能齐全的 Python 开发环境。Vim 是一款强大的文本编辑器,因其高度可定制性和高效的操作方式深受程序员喜爱。在...

    Python-VisualStudioCode的Python扩展

    总的来说,"Python-VisualStudioCode的Python扩展"是Python开发者的得力工具,它通过集成各种实用功能,将VS Code转变为一个专业且高效的Python IDE,满足从初学者到高级开发者的需求。通过不断地更新和优化,这个...

    python最佳实践指南--中文版

    《Python最佳实践指南》是一本面向Python初学者和高级用户的宝贵资源,旨在提供关于Python语言安装、配置以及日常使用的实用建议和策略。这份中文版的指南不仅涵盖了基础内容,也深入探讨了Python编程的最佳实践,以...

    python安装及插件.zip

    接下来,我们来讨论"PyDev 3.5.0.zip",这是一个专门为Eclipse集成开发环境(IDE)设计的Python插件。PyDev是强大的Python IDE扩展,它提供了一系列功能,如代码补全、调试、语法高亮、重构等,极大地提高了Python...

    PythonScript插件用于notepad++的

    这个插件极大地扩展了Notepad++的功能,使得它不仅仅是一个文本编辑器,更是一个轻量级的集成开发环境(IDE)。 **安装PythonScript** 安装PythonScript插件的过程相当简单。首先,你需要下载与Notepad++版本兼容...

    python开发工具 windows下python环境

    - Python官方文档是学习Python的最佳参考资料。 - 在线教育平台如Coursera、Udemy、edX等提供Python课程。 - Stack Overflow和GitHub上的社区可以帮助解决实际开发中遇到的问题。 掌握这些基础知识后,你将能够...

    python_IDE_presentation

    6. **Python_IDE_presentation-master**:这个文件名可能是指一个关于Python IDE的演示文稿或者项目,可能包含有关不同IDE的比较、使用教程、最佳实践等内容。 总的来说,Python IDE的选择因人而异,理解它们的功能...

    python3.5.3.zip

    Python 3.5.3是Python编程语言的一个版本,发布于2017年,它在Python 3.x系列中占据着重要的位置。这个压缩包文件"python3.5.3.zip"很可能是包含了Python 3.5.3的安装程序或者源代码,方便用户下载和使用。Python是...

    python programming on win32

    这本书不仅适合初学者了解Python在Windows平台上的使用,也对有经验的开发者提供了大量实用的技巧和最佳实践,是Python程序员在Windows环境下工作的重要参考资料。通过阅读和实践,读者可以掌握如何充分利用Python的...

    Python最佳学习路线图

    以上是Python学习的最佳路线图概述,每个阶段都包含了理论知识学习与实践操作环节,旨在帮助学习者系统地掌握Python编程技能,并能够应用于实际工作中。通过不断深入探索各个领域,可以逐步成长为一名优秀的Python...

    Python-用于创建隔离及便携的开发环境的一个轻量平台

    在标签“Python开发-集成开发环境”中,我们可以深入探讨Python开发的一些最佳实践。首先,理解Python的标准库是必要的,它包含了大量的模块和函数,能帮助开发者快速实现各种功能。其次,学习如何编写可读性强、...

    手机上使用的python编译器

    - **Pydroid 3**: Pydroid 3是一款专为Android设计的Python IDE,它包含了完整的Python环境,包括Python解释器、代码编辑器和集成调试器。 - **Kivy**: Kivy是一个开源Python库,用于开发多点触控应用程序,也可以...

    python_____3.6.8-amd64.rar

    - Python自带了一个集成开发环境(IDE),名为IDLE,适合初学者进行代码编写和调试。但也有许多其他流行的Python IDE,如PyCharm、VS Code和Jupyter Notebook等。 7. **应用领域**: - Python广泛应用于Web开发...

    Python 3.10.14 for Windows 自编译版

    在Windows环境下使用Python,通常需要考虑一些特定的配置和工具,比如设置环境变量以便在命令行中直接运行Python,或者安装集成开发环境(IDE),如Visual Studio Code或PyCharm,以提供代码编辑、调试和项目管理等...

    python课程设计完整 五子棋

    8. 版本控制:.idea文件可能是IntelliJ IDEA或PyCharm等IDE的项目配置文件,表明开发过程中可能使用了版本控制系统如Git,用于代码版本管理与协作。 9. 文档编写:五子棋.doc可能是项目报告,包含了项目背景、设计...

    Python-100-Days-master.zip

    `Python编程惯例.md`可能会深入探讨一些Python编程的最佳实践,包括设计模式、错误处理、模块化和面向对象编程等方面,这对于编写高质量的Python代码很有帮助。 `Python参考书籍.md`列出了值得阅读的Python相关书籍...

Global site tag (gtag.js) - Google Analytics